WebThe wage garnishment law specifies that its limitations on the amount of earnings that may be garnished do not apply to certain bankruptcy court orders, or to debts due for federal or state taxes. In a given fiscal year (FY), when spending (ex. money for roadways) exceeds revenue (ex. money from federal income tax), a budget deficit results.

WebMar 28, 2024 · The Bureau of the Fiscal Service (BFS), which is part of the Treasury Department, initiates refund offsets to outstanding federal agency debts or child support, state income tax obligations and unemployment compensation debts. These offsets are referred to as Treasury Offset Program (TOP) offsets. This notice, or letter may include …
